KatadataOTO – The Chery car fire in Bekasi is still receiving public attention. This is because customers are worried that the vehicles they buy later might be remnants from the incident that have been repaired by the company.
Aware of this, PT Chery Sales Indonesia ensures that the remaining burnt cars will not be used. They plan to destroy the remaining vehicles to ensure product quality in the country.
“The units from the fire cannot be repaired, so we will destroy them 100 percent,” said Budi Darmawan, Sales Director of PT CSI to the media (24/03).
Although the number of burnt units is estimated to be around 100, he revealed that product availability will not be significantly affected. This is because Chery has already prepared stock for customers.
“The number of burnt units is around 90 to 100, but we are still calculating the details. Coincidentally, we have also prepared sufficient stock so that vehicle deliveries before Eid will not be disrupted,” he said.
However, he admitted that customers who make purchases after Eid will have to wait a little longer.
“But the additional waiting time will not be too long, perhaps only a one-week delay from the initial promise,” he then added.
He also emphasized that his party is currently still investigating the cause of the incident. An investigation is necessary to avoid similar occurrences in the future.
“The cause of the fire is still under investigation. Meanwhile, the total losses have not yet been fully calculated,” Budi affirmed.
It was previously reported that a fire had occurred involving knocked-down kit Omoda 5 cars with gasoline engines. This was proven by a photo of a vehicle with a fuel tank opening.
This incident went viral because rumors circulated that the burning cars were Electric Vehicles. As a result, there was a potential loss of public trust in electric vehicles, even though the market is currently growing.
Therefore, Chery responded to this issue quite seriously and confirmed that the burnt units were not electric vehicles.
